      jiyen235, 20 Feb 2025sure bud. keep eating up the marketing stuff.It is not marketing. It has been tested.

      Imx888 has 80% of FWC compared to Type 1.0.
      When imx888 is barely more than 40% of Type 1.0 size.

      Its FWC is 2x more than imx789 , that has exactly same specs ( 4,3:3 shape , 52mp total with 48mp effective).

      Exmor T only needs to be 1/1.28" to match Lyt900.
      Less space used, less voltage, less heat, thinner bump.

      Exmor RS has first layer with 50% pixel area + 50% logic layer.
      Moving logic layer beneath, now surface is only for pixels.

      Photodiodes are taller compared to exmor RS. Electronic microscopy was done to show extructure.
